Celebrities often ignore their trolls on social media, but sometimes the temptation to clap back is, shall we say, irresistible. Jessica Simpson is back performing music and she jumped right into the replies on her Instagram channel when one user expressed shock that the early 2000s icon was still in the business. "Is she still performing? Who would bother to see her?" the user wrote under a Thursday, September 18 video of Simpson, 45, rehearsing her cover of Robbie Williams' 1997 song "Angels." "If you're in the Chicago area on Saturday I would love to comp you two tickets," Simpson replied. It's part of a string of tour dates on the calendar as she wades back into live music. She first returned to the stage in March at the Recording Academy's Austin Chapter Block Party at South By Southwest in Austin, Texas, where she debuted two new songs, "Breadcrumbs" and "Leave." It was Simpson's first live performance in 15 years and she took to Instagram after to thank the fans who turned out. "It was an emotional coming back home to the best part of myself," she wrote under a video of footage from her set. "Thank you for embracing me. You know that I have so much to say, but this lucky voice gets to soar again tonight. I love y'all. More to come." Simpson's return to music comes just months after she announced her split from her husband, former NFL tight end Eric Johnson in January. The two married in 2014 and share daughters Maxwell, 12, and Birdie, 5, as well as son Ace, 11. The two were spotted together in August at Jessica's sister Ashlee Simpson's Las Vegas residency, but a source told Us Weekly at the time that it was nothing to read into. "They are not getting back together or reconciling," the source explained, adding, "It was a family event, and Eric was being supportive. He wanted to support Ashlee."
